Caseworkers are required by guideline to check out the kid or youth at the very least month-to-month in the home to figure out safety and security, permanency and wellness. These visits will consist of the foster moms and dad(s), yet the worker also is needed to see the child or young people outside the existence of others to determine the child or youth's security and health.



A child/youth might be qualified to receive fostering aid, which may include a month-to-month economic settlement, Medicaid, non-recurring adoption costs or situation services (services which Medicaid does not cover). This is based upon the child/youth's needs and the family members's scenarios. A fostering aid arrangement conference with the area division and prospective adoptive moms and dad(s) should take place before and an adoption aid contract have to be authorized prior to the finalization of fostering.

The kid or young people will legitimately become component of their new family at this hearing. Post-permanency solutions and support can be given to continue to sustain adoptive households after an adoption has been settled.

Adoption prepared vetting ways different things for canines of various ages. For pets under 3 months old, they will call for a wellness examination and 2 rounds of the DAPP injection before being taken on. For dogs older than 3 months, a wellness examination and a round of yearly vaccinations should be completed (DAPP, Bordetella and Rabies).



In that case, it is completed post-adoption, with the aid of an appointed vetting planner, and at no additional expense to the adopter. Frequently, a silicon chip is placed when the yearly shots are administered (pre-adoption), yet some veterinarians encourage awaiting the spay/neuter treatment and placing the chip while the canine is under anesthetic.

If your pet does not have actually a microchip dental implanted upon fostering, it's essential they have identification tags on in all times. Canines that have actions or health issues might not be detailed on the web site for an extended time period. Healthy, well-behaved pet dogs normally will be placed on the site within two to 4 weeks of getting to their foster home.
